Summary
If a user is unable to authenticate the appliance due to a lost password, a full system reset and format must be performed. This article describes how to reset the system with a standard reset and a data protection method.
Resetting a BLAZE Recording Box System
There are two methods to reset the BLAZE Recording Box (BRB) system: the standard reset and the data protection exception method, which will prevent loss of recorded data.
Standard Reset
IMPORTANT: This process erases all recorded data. It is imperative to inform the
customer of this data loss before proceeding.
To perform a standard reset:
- Locate the reset button in the recess on the back of the appliance.
- Press and hold it for 10 seconds.
- Follow the on-screen instructions to complete the setup.
Data Protection Exception
To perform a hardware reset without losing recorded data:
- Remove the HDD from the appliance before initiating the reset.
- Hold the reset button for 10 seconds.
Reinsert the HDD once the reset is complete.
Registering with the same camera previously registered enables playback of the same camera stored on the HDD.
